Output 59dfe07291bebef84ce382f74fdc3c9e1c392caae03666d7fa88f8939a672bb4:3

value
673000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d110a96b5a30084d780f3d152a10c48f598a832 OP_EQUAL
address
35oJkELQN1GwYFWBumqgj7quLvQe23XP3K
transaction
59dfe07291bebef84ce382f74fdc3c9e1c392caae03666d7fa88f8939a672bb4
spent
true